#ecc006 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ecc006 is composed of 92.5% red, 75.3%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.6% magenta, 97.5%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 48.5 degrees, a saturation of 95% and a lightness of 47.5%. #ecc006 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ff0c with #d98100.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c00.

Shades and Tints of #ecc006
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060500 is the darkest color, while #fffcf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ecc006
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7b76 is the less saturated color, while #ecc006 is the most saturated one.
